  • Patent number: 4201585
    Abstract: The processing of exposed photographic silver halide color materials is described while using a bleach or bleach-fixing bath containing better bleach-accelerating compounds. The bleach-accelerating compounds are polyoxyethylene compounds comprising at least 20 mol % of recurring oxyethylene units, which carry a thioether group in a sidechain.

  • Patent number: 4072526
    Abstract: A method is described of developing a photographic silver halide element containing developable silver halide by development in the presence of a development accelerator which is a polyaddition compound having recurring units of the following general formula, the recurring units containing at least one thioether sulphur atom linked to two carbon atoms: ##STR1## wherein: Q is --O--, --S--, --S alkylene S-- or --O alkylene O-- wherein the alkylene group may be interrupted by oxygen or sulphur,Each of X.sub.1 and X.sub.2 represents oxygen or sulphur,Alk stands for alkylene which may be interrupted by oxygen or sulphur, andR is hydrogen or COR.sub.1, SO.sub.2 R.sub.1 or CONHR.sub.1 wherein R.sub.1 is an alkyl group or an aryl group andWherein at least one of R, Q, X.sub.1, Alk and X.sub.2 is or comprises a thioether sulphur atom.
